There are different types of floor coatings, among them is the epoxy floor coating which is widely used on industrial floors, residential garage and basement floors and even office facilities. The epoxy basically comprises two components; the resin element which is a light, odor free and shadeless and the opposite component is the hardener which is often dark in coloration and has a strong smell. With proper mixture and correct quantity, the mixture will create a chemical reaction thereby producing a powerful plastic materials guaranteed to last for a protracted time.
What’s epoxy?
An epoxy is a cloth made of liquid polymer and is transformed to solid polymer with proper mixture attributable to chemical reaction. An epoxy which is polymer primarily based is chemical resistant to decay, mechanically powerful and highly adhesive. Epoxy can also be heat resistant and a very good insulator for electrical purposes.
What are the advantages of epoxy floor coating?
For one, epoxy floor coating could be very reliable when it involves durability. The mixture will also be adjusted according to the specific need of your garage or facility. The resin will be adjusted so as to meet your desired hardness or elasticity. And since it may be adjusted, you can also request to add shade on the mixture to come up with your desired color and style of your garage floor. By utilizing epoxy floor coating, you get a durable and at the similar time, a decorative coating on your floor.

Advancements in Epoxy Floor Coating Technology
Epoxy coating quality covers a wide range depending on use. There are Do It Your self kits available for basements and garage floors. But you get what you pay for. Epoxy paint kits found in lots of house improvement stores are little more than a paint that can’t withstand the hot tires of your automobile or truck despite what it says on the label. In recent times on-line retailers have launched high performance Do It Your self systems with a durable urethane top coat.
Professional installers will use systems with sand built in to quite a few layers for heavy visitors in warehouses and high visitors areas.
Polyaspartics and Polyureas
In the last few years a new breed of floor coating has been launched called polyureas and polyaspartics. These new coatings have distinctive characteristics such as being able to withstand cold weather applications and flexibility preventing cracking. These products have been originally developed for coating metal to forestall corrosion. Their exceptional performance and quick curing led to different applications most notably on concrete. Although there are a number of corporations promoting a polyaspartic system for the do it your self market they’re an advanced coating that should be left to the professionals.
